Ulefone Note 17 Pro Price in Bangladesh
The Ulefone Note 17 Pro is priced at ৳40,000 in Bangladesh for the 12GB RAM and 256GB storage variant. Globally, it retails at around $319.99.
Launched in January 2025, the Ulefone Note 17 Pro is a stylish mid-range smartphone that blends strong performance, a striking design, and a large AMOLED display with a high refresh rate. With a 108MP primary camera, 12GB RAM, and Helio G99 processor, this phone is built to deliver a smooth user experience whether you’re gaming, streaming, or capturing high-quality photos. It stands out with its bold color options, massive battery, and surprisingly capable front camera, making it a compelling choice in the mid-tier category.
Ulefone Note 17 Pro Specifications
Display and Design
The Ulefone Note 17 Pro boasts a 6.78-inch AMOLED display with a resolution of 1080 x 2400 pixels and a crisp 388 PPI density. It supports a 120Hz refresh rate, delivering ultra-smooth visuals for scrolling and gaming, along with 500 nits of brightness for clear outdoor visibility. Although it lacks a named protective glass, its edge-to-edge panel with ~91.3% screen-to-body ratio ensures an immersive viewing experience.
Design-wise, the phone features a sleek yet sturdy build with dimensions of 163.8 x 74.2 x 9 mm and a manageable weight of 197.8g. It is available in three standout finishes—Velvet Black, Pearl White, and Amber Orange—each adding a unique aesthetic appeal.
Performance and Processor
Powered by the MediaTek Helio G99 (6nm) chipset, the Ulefone Note 17 Pro delivers solid mid-range performance. Its octa-core CPU (2×2.2 GHz Cortex-A76 & 6×2.0 GHz Cortex-A55) and Mali-G57 MC2 GPU ensure reliable handling of day-to-day tasks, moderate gaming, and multitasking.
With 12GB of RAM and 256GB of UFS 2.2 storage, the phone provides a smooth and responsive experience, even with demanding apps. While it doesn’t feature expandable storage, the large built-in capacity should suffice for most users’ needs.
Camera and Video
The Ulefone Note 17 Pro comes with a dual rear camera setup, led by a 108MP primary sensor and a 5MP secondary lens, likely used for macro or depth shots. The camera supports video recording up to 1440p@30fps, and includes features like AI enhancements and night mode, making it suitable for various lighting conditions.
On the front, a 32MP wide-angle selfie camera with an f/2.5 aperture ensures sharp and detailed selfies. It supports 1080p video recording, ideal for video calls and social media content.
Battery and Charging
Equipped with a 5050mAh Li-Ion battery, the Ulefone Note 17 Pro promises a full day of moderate to heavy use. It supports 33W fast charging, allowing users to quickly top up the battery when needed. Though it lacks wireless charging, the large capacity and efficiency of the Helio G99 chipset contribute to reliable endurance.
Connectivity and 5G Support
While the Ulefone Note 17 Pro doesn’t support 5G, it offers comprehensive 4G LTE band coverage along with dual SIM slots, making it a versatile option for global and local networks.
Other connectivity features include:
- Bluetooth 5.2
- USB Type-C 2.0
- GPS with GLONASS, GALILEO, and BDS
- Wi-Fi hotspot capability
- FM radio and 3.5mm headphone jack
